Compliance & Conformity
- EN388: Abrasion Level 4, Cut Level 2, Tear Level 4, Puncture Level 4
- EN12477:
- Burning Behaviour: Level 4
- Contact Heat: Level 3
- Convective Heat: Level 3
- Radiant Heat: Level 1
- Molten Metal: Level 4
 
- Chemical Resistance: Not suitable for acids, bases, or solvents
- Cold Resistance: Suitable for general cold applications

Frequently Asked Questions
Q1: Are these gloves suitable for MIG and TIG welding?
A: Yes, they are ideal for general-purpose welding including MIG. For TIG, consider a glove with more dexterity.
Q2: Do I need special training to use these gloves?
A: No special training is required. Just ensure proper fit and use them as intended.
Q3: Can I use these gloves for chemical handling?
A: No, they are not suitable for acids, bases, or solvents.
Q4: Are they compatible with other PPE like sleeves or jackets?
A: Yes, the 35cm length and turned hems make them easy to pair with welding jackets and sleeves.
Q5: How do I clean these gloves?
A: Wipe with a damp cloth. Do not machine wash or dry.
Q6: Are they heatproof or just heat-resistant?
A: They are heat-resistant up to EN12477 standards but not fully heatproof. Always follow safety guidelines.
